1214 Commits

Author SHA1 Message Date
Mattia Tollari
1f21b6b70e Merge remote-tracking branch 'origin/R_10_00' into R_10_00 2019-06-25 17:32:51 +02:00
Mattia Tollari
98a38dd34d Patch level : 12.0 844
Files correlati     : fp0, fp0500a.msk
Commento            :
- Sistemata maschera fp0500 per lo sheet altri dati gestionali
- Corretto indice passato a load_adg_paf() nelle righe del documento
- Tolto inserimento riga "Altri dati gestionali" se non vengono scritti altri dati gestionali
- Corretta lettura e scrittura record FPCUSTADG durante il salvataggio
- Aggiunti left() a campi nuovi per evitare data binary truncation
- Sistamato controllo booleano split
- Sistemato controllo simbolo in split_condition()
- Sistemata parse_var per variabili vuote
2019-06-25 17:32:44 +02:00
Simone Palacino
1326e6361f Patch level : 12.0 846
Files correlati     : cg2.exe cg2FPPRO.msk
Commento            : Corretta sintassi di una classe
2019-06-25 15:02:44 +02:00
Simone Palacino
08f2915f28 Patch level : 12.0 846
Files correlati     : cg2.exe cg2FPPRO.msk
Commento            :
- Cambiata icona ricarica fatture su 'Fatture SDI'
- Aggiunta importazione percent. e natura iva da ini con f1
2019-06-25 14:54:19 +02:00
Simone Palacino
c313825816 Patch level : 12.0 844
Files correlati     : fp0.exe
Commento            : Aggiunta esportazione percentuale e natura iva per f1
2019-06-25 14:49:58 +02:00
Simone Palacino
50940896e4 Patch level : 12.0 842
Files correlati     : fp0.exe fp0400a.msk
Commento            : Aggiunto controllo contabilizzazione senza cod. fornitore
2019-06-25 12:01:30 +02:00
Simone Palacino
e32b198b47 Patch level : 12.0 842
Files correlati     : fp0.exe fp0400a.msk
Commento            : Aggiunto controllo contabilizzazione senza cod. fornitore
2019-06-25 12:00:58 +02:00
Mattia Tollari
aea092103f Merge remote-tracking branch 'origin/R_10_00' into R_10_00 2019-06-25 11:51:51 +02:00
Mattia Tollari
17c72490cf Patch level : 12.0 840
Files correlati     : fp0, fp0500a.msk
Commento            :
Aggiornamento programma personalizzazioni FP:
- Sistemata maschera
- Aggiunto AND e OR nella condizione
- Aggiunto preload con dati base durante la creazione di una personalizzazione
2019-06-25 11:51:35 +02:00
Simone Palacino
c5a8b5eb75 Patch level : 12.0 838
Files correlati     : fp0.exe
Commento            : Aggiunto numero fornitore nel log da fatture annullate
2019-06-25 10:51:14 +02:00
Simone Palacino
29203430bc Patch level : 12.0 838
Files correlati     : fp0400a.msk
Commento            : Corretta visualizzazione totale doc. con solo 2 cifre dec.
2019-06-25 10:38:19 +02:00
Simone Palacino
9b57cbc648 Patch level : 12.0 838
Files correlati     : cg2.exe cg2FPPRO.msk
Commento            :
- Corretto importo totale con ritenuta
- Aggiunto bottone in maschera fppro per solo collegamento senza riporto dati
2019-06-25 10:21:15 +02:00
Simone Palacino
fbca7b8365 Patch level : 12.0 836
Files correlati     : cg2.exe cg2FPPRO.msk
Commento            :
- Aggiunta ritenuta da acconto da F1
- Corretto importo totale
2019-06-24 18:10:50 +02:00
Simone Palacino
82c61d5f93 Patch level : 12.0 836
Files correlati     : fp0.exe
Commento            :
- Esportazione da f1-fp delle ritenute di acconto
- Correzione se importo e' nullo
2019-06-24 18:09:04 +02:00
Mattia Tollari
c3430ae494 Patch level : 12.0 834
Files correlati     : ve
Commento            : Aggiornamento anagrafica tipo documento con il codice della personalizzazione FP
2019-06-24 14:49:33 +02:00
Mattia Tollari
50f634f20c Patch level : 12.0 834
Files correlati     : cg
Commento            : Aggiornamento anagrafica clienti con il codice della personalizzazione FP
2019-06-24 14:49:08 +02:00
Mattia Tollari
7fb14d7c7d Patch level : 12.0 no-patch
Files correlati     : fe
Commento            : Sistemata libreria felib per errore link TVariant
2019-06-24 14:48:55 +02:00
Mattia Tollari
0f7685b104 Patch level : 12.0 834
Files correlati     : cg
Commento            : Aggiornamento anagrafica clienti con il codice della personalizzazione FP
2019-06-24 14:48:20 +02:00
Mattia Tollari
7b8adafb9a Patch level : 12.0 834
Files correlati     : fp
Commento            :
- Prima release (da testare) personalizzazioni fatture elettroniche
- Modificata esportazione fatture per supportare le personalizzazioni
- Aggiornamento DB
2019-06-24 14:47:17 +02:00
Simone Palacino
87a413090f Patch level : 12.0 832
Files correlati     : fp0400.msk
Commento            : Aggiunto controllo data sulla maschera
2019-06-24 09:54:50 +02:00
Simone Palacino
19272e0564 Patch level : 12.0 830
Files correlati     : cg2.exe cg2100c.msk
Commento            : - [Prima nota] Aggiunta percentuale iva e natura su sheet iva
2019-06-21 13:11:45 +02:00
Simone Palacino
6e5ebe6716 Patch level : 12.0 830
Files correlati     : cg2.exe
Commento            :
- [Prima nota] Corretta importazione da f1 di imposta e imponibile
2019-06-20 18:34:10 +02:00
Simone Palacino
1fbf34ce1f Patch level : 12.0 830
Files correlati     : cg2.exe
Commento            :
- [Prima nota] Aggiunto calcolo totdoc da ini f1 se non valorizzato
- Corretti controlli FPPRO quando salvo un movimento
2019-06-20 17:01:49 +02:00
Simone Palacino
1868cc986d Patch level : 12.0 830
Files correlati     : cg2.exe
Commento            :
- [Prima nota] Filtro data documento passato in automatico se valorizzato
- Esportazione da 'Fatture SDI' delle righe IVA e scadenze
- Controllo Totale documento se zero sommo da righe IVA
2019-06-20 10:41:56 +02:00
Simone Palacino
6c85a4d22f Merge remote-tracking branch 'origin/R_10_00' into R_10_00 2019-06-20 10:31:27 +02:00
Simone Palacino
e3d8fbfc28 Patch level : 12.0 828
Files correlati     : fp0.exe
Commento            : [contab. F1] Controlla di non inserire righe IVA vuote
2019-06-20 10:31:12 +02:00
4a8c9d11cd Patch level : 12.0 828
Files correlati     : cg5.exe

Issue #47
dopo l'installazione della patch 826, se da visualizzazione liquidazione clicco sul bottone all'estrema sinistra e richiamo il mese, all'uscita mi viene raddoppiato il mese di dicembre
2019-06-19 23:09:50 +02:00
Simone Palacino
82cc21e3d6 Merge remote-tracking branch 'origin/R_10_00' into R_10_00 2019-06-19 14:28:18 +02:00
Simone Palacino
7ee01f73ca Patch level : 12.0 826
Files correlati     : cg2.exe cg2FPPRO.msk
Commento            :
- Lasciata la possibilita' di collegare documenti anche senza F1 senza riporto dei dati
- Aggiunti altri tipi documento per causale accettate per F1
2019-06-19 14:28:02 +02:00
79fb38da25 Patch level : 12.0 826
Files correlati     : cg5.exe

la visualizzazione della liquidazione -> Prospetto complessivo -> Versamenti e valorizza i campi il programma si blocca.
2019-06-19 11:13:48 +02:00
Simone Palacino
d3d81d215e Patch level : 12.0 826
Files correlati     : fp0.exe fp0400a.msk
Commento            :
- Rimosso cod. sdi da tabella e esportazione contabiliz.
- Rifatta maschera:
- Spostato codice caus. cont. in elenco fatt
- Tolto cod caus per Nota credito
- Sistemata gestione flag e radiobox
- Aggiunto controllo cod caus errato per TD01 TD04
- Aggiunta classe per gestione FPPRO
- Aggiunti ulteriori dati per importazione nuovo fornitore
- Aggiunto a header di MOV "NUMDOCEXT"
- Corretto log con num. doc. esteso
- Cambiato nome "Codice protocollo" in "Tipo protocollo"
- Cambiato nome colonna Salvato FPPRO con Fornitore associato
2019-06-18 14:40:51 +02:00
Simone Palacino
01cd186e68 Patch level : 12.0 no-patch
Files correlati     : f9
Commento            : Aggiunto file al progetto
2019-06-13 17:44:41 +02:00
Simone Palacino
5658145334 Merge branch 'R_10_00' of http://10.65.20.33/sirio/CAMPO/campo into R_10_00 2019-06-13 17:43:40 +02:00
Simone Palacino
783f6ca9b6 Patch level : 12.0 no-patch
Files correlati     : build
Commento            : Aggiunto nuovo progetto F9
2019-06-13 17:43:30 +02:00
Simone Palacino
02b8cce7e3 Patch level : 12.0 824
Files correlati     : ef0.exe
Commento            : Corretta ricerca IBAN da cfven (non esiste) a cfban/tab(BAN)
2019-06-13 17:40:53 +02:00
Mattia Tollari
2582b6c7b4 Patch level : 12.0 no-patch
Files correlati     : fp
Commento            : Continuo sviluppo personalizzazioni FP
- Creata classe ad-hoc (TFP_expression) per il controllo delle espressioni così da non avere la classe TDoc_fp piena di roba
- Aggiunte funzioni comuni e lettura delle condizioni
- Inserita gestione delle variabili tramite TVariant (con allocazione furba) per effettuare delle comparazioni migliori
2019-06-12 17:29:35 +02:00
Mattia Tollari
751102232e Patch level : 12.0 no-patch
Files correlati     : include
Commento            : Tolta funzione get_tmp_var() da TRecordset e messa in TVariant, inoltre aggiornata l'implementazione come quella di get_tmp_string (creato array da 1024 celle, messo un controllo diverso per tornare alla prima posizione)
2019-06-12 17:26:14 +02:00
Mattia Tollari
dd33d88b34 Patch level : 12.0 822
Files correlati     : tp0.exe
Commento            : Aggiunta message_box con codice dell'articolo avente conai errato durante l'importazione
2019-06-12 15:35:21 +02:00
Mattia Tollari
8135c22137 Patch level : 12.0 822
Files correlati     : mr0.exe
Commento            : Aggiunta ora e minuti al salvataggio del file di rilevazione dei terminalini per aumentare la precisione
2019-06-12 15:34:29 +02:00
Mattia Tollari
f417fee58f Merge remote-tracking branch 'origin/R_10_00' into R_10_00 2019-06-11 15:13:31 +02:00
Mattia Tollari
30ed447206 Patch level : 12.0 no-patch
Files correlati     : fp
Commento            : Aggiunti files DB
2019-06-11 15:10:27 +02:00
Simone Palacino
76ab6fec41 Patch level : 12.0 820
Files correlati     : ve5.exe, ve5100a.msk
Commento            : Aggiunte funzione di zip unzip per file senza floppy
2019-06-11 12:10:17 +02:00
Simone Palacino
8a6a484f54 Patch level : 12.0 820
Files correlati     : ve5.exe, ve5100a.msk
Commento            : Aggiunta archiviazione su File oltre al Floppy
2019-06-11 12:08:47 +02:00
Mattia Tollari
5782fa12d3 Patch level : 12.0 no-patch
Files correlati     : include
Commento            : Nuovi files
2019-06-11 11:35:20 +02:00
Mattia Tollari
398b77ac67 Merge remote-tracking branch 'origin/R_10_00' into R_10_00 2019-06-11 11:13:05 +02:00
Mattia Tollari
2aab5ea277 Patch level : 12.0 no-patch
Files correlati     : include
Commento            :
- Aggiunti nuovi files a lffiles

Implementate funzioni in TString
- replace(const char*, const char*): sostituisce una stringa con quella passata (prima c'era solo la versione con char)
- contains(char, int): controlla se la stringa contiene il carattere passato
- contains(const char*, int): controlla se la stringa contiene la stringa passata

Implementata funzione in TToken_string:
- const char* remove(int): rimuove un token dalla stringa e lo ritorna

- Aggiunta funzione is_multi_table(int) in utility.h che ritorna se il file è un multitracciato
2019-06-11 11:07:47 +02:00
Mattia Tollari
579caa00ef Patch level : 12.0 no-patch
Files correlati     : fp
Commento            : Aggiornamento programma anagrafica personalizzazioni, aggiunto flag globale, aggiustata grafica (non ancora terminato)
2019-06-11 11:02:18 +02:00
Mattia Tollari
2cc174f686 Patch level : 12.0 no-patch
Files correlati     : fp
Commento            : Aggiunto parser che legge una sintassi molto semplice per riempire le personalizzazioni di Campo, attualmente sono funzioni statiche, non ho ancora deciso se tenerle così
2019-06-11 11:01:11 +02:00
Simone Palacino
9c5bbf8a20 Patch level : 12.0 820
Files correlati     : cg2.exe
Commento            :
- Correzione maschera cg2300a per compatibilita' con schermi piu' piccoli
- Visualizzate solo registrazioni con flag liq. mese prec.
- Modificate posizioni campi prima nota
2019-06-11 10:21:35 +02:00
Simone Palacino
37704d8ef8 Merge remote-tracking branch 'origin/R_10_00' into R_10_00 2019-06-11 09:50:17 +02:00